/Sounds like "sehr" + "pahn" + "ee" (as in "see") + "mahn" (as in "man") + "teh" (as in "ten" without "n") + "KEE" (as in "key") + "yah" (as in "yacht")/
To be inseparable friends, that duo that always goes everywhere together like a perfect combination. It's the Latino way of saying two people work so well together they just don't function as well apart.
"Those two are like peanut butter and jelly, always together."
"They've been inseparable since they were kids."
